There are primarily two purposes for which business plan are written. The first has an outside objective--to obtain funding. The second serves an inside purpose--to provide a plan for early corporate development: to guide an organization toward meeting its objectives, to keep the entrepreneurial business itself and all its decision makers headed in a predetermined direction
